Here’s the Lineup for Filmland 2020

The past few weeks have been full of exciting developments on this year’s Filmland event. Not only did the annual Arkansas Cinema Society film festival announce it’s going drive-in style at the new MP Outdoor Cinema alongside an at-home virtual screening option, but now a lineup containing Oscar-buzzworthy films has locals counting down the days. 

Here’s your guide to Filmland 2020.

 

Oct. 1

  • 7:15 p.m. – “The Way I See It”
  • Following the movie – Q&A with former Chief Official White House Photographer Pete Souza and producers Jayme Lemons and Evan Hayes

 

Oct 2

  • Prior to the main event – screening of Filmland: Arkansas Shorts program audience award winner
  • 7:15 p.m. – “One Night in Miami…” 
  • Following the movie – Q&A with writer/executive producer Kemp Powers and actor Eli Goree, moderated by ACS co-founder Jeff Nichols 

 

Oct. 3

  • Prior to the main event – “Super Human” short film premiere by Filmmaking Lab for Teen Girls participants
  • 7:15 p.m. – “Nomadland”
  • Following the movie – Q&A with director Chloé Zhao

 

Oct. 4

  • Prior to the main event – screening of Filmland: Arkansas Student Shorts program audience award winner
  • 7:15 p.m. – “Dreamland”
  • Following the movie – Q&A with actor Margot Robbie and director Miles Joris-Peyrafitte

Oct. 7

This screening will take place virtually and is a joint event marking the end of Filmland and the start of the Hot Springs Documentary Film Festival.

  • 7 p.m. – “You Cannot Kill David Arquette”
  • Following the movie – Q&A with filmmakers David and Christina McLarty Arquette

 

The organization’s mission is to “[build] a film community in Arkansas where film lovers can watch films, share ideas, connect with each other and nurture the new and existing film talent within our state through increased exposure to filmmakers and their art.”
